What is 2 1/4?
2 1/4 is a mixed numeral that represents a fraction in mathematics. It is a combination of a whole number and a fraction. In this case, the whole number is 2, and the fraction is 1/4.
Breaking Down 2 1/4
To understand 2 1/4, let's break it down into its components:
- 2: This is the whole number part of the mixed numeral. It represents 2 complete units.
- 1/4: This is the fraction part of the mixed numeral. It represents 1 out of 4 equal parts.
Converting 2 1/4 to an Improper Fraction
To convert 2 1/4 to an improper fraction, we can multiply the whole number part (2) by the denominator (4) and then add the numerator (1):
2 × 4 = 8 8 + 1 = 9
So, 2 1/4 is equivalent to the improper fraction 9/4.
Real-World Applications of 2 1/4
2 1/4 has various real-world applications, such as:
- Measurement: 2 1/4 can be used to measure lengths, heights, or distances. For example, a piece of wood might be 2 1/4 inches long.
- Recipe: 2 1/4 can be used in recipes to specify ingredient quantities. For example, a recipe might require 2 1/4 cups of flour.
- Time: 2 1/4 can be used to represent time intervals. For example, a task might take 2 hours and 15 minutes to complete.
